HVC Cigars has announced the release of its Edicion Especial 2015, a cigar line featuring updated packaging and a modified blend. The new design introduces a soft box-press Cuban style, available in five vitolas. This release coincides with the companyโs 10-year anniversary celebration of the Edicion Especial series.
The cigars are produced using aged tobaccos sourced from two farms in Jalapa and Esteli, Nicaragua, and are finished with a San Andres Maduro wrapper. The lineup includes Especiales (48 x 6 ยฝ), Corona Gorda (46 x 5 5/8), Short Robusto (52 x 4 ยฝ), Toro (54 x 6), and El Grandote (60 x 6). The Especiales size is a limited edition, with only 1,000 boxes of 10 cigars each, while the other sizes will be part of regular production, packaged in 20-count boxes. Retail prices range from $9.00 to $12.60 per cigar, depending on the vitola. The cigars are expected to be available by mid-June.
โThis evolution reflects our dedication to craftsmanship, innovation and the ever-evolving preferences of our customers,โ said Reinier Lorenzo, Founder and CEO of HVC Cigars. The release is crafted at Fabrica de Tabacos HVC, SA, in Nicaragua, maintaining the brandโs focus on its heritage and quality standards.
